memory: omap-gpmc: Support general purpose input for WAITPINs
OMAPs can have 2 to 4 WAITPINs that can be used as general purpose input if not used for memory wait state insertion. The first user will be the OMAP NAND chip to get the NAND read/busy status using gpiolib.
